Output ec9966625aadcb12fc80c13d9d8fab109de746da4a2b181f75256647c262f32e:1

value
2124160
script pubkey
OP_0 OP_PUSHBYTES_20 94075da10325bf575a28cdaee75a721bf9fe3603
address
ltc1qjsr4mggrykl4wk3gekhwwknjr0uludsrppmzf5
transaction
ec9966625aadcb12fc80c13d9d8fab109de746da4a2b181f75256647c262f32e
spent
true